防止恶意软件攻击是保护Linux系统安全的重要环节。以下是一些有效的措施和最佳实践,可以帮助你增强系统的安全性:
apt、yum、dnf等)是最新的,并定期更新所有已安装的软件包。sudo apt update && sudo apt upgrade
s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T # 允许SSH
s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T # 允许HTTP
s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T # 允许HTTPS
sudo iptables -P INPUT DROP # 拒绝所有其他入站连接
sudo ufw enable
sudo ufw allow 22/tcp
sudo ufw allow 80/tcp
sudo ufw allow 443/tcp
sudo apt install clamav clamtk
sudo freshclam # 更新病毒库
sudo clamscan -r / # 扫描整个系统
rsync、tar等工具进行备份。/var/log/syslog、/var/log/auth.log)以发现异常活动。fail2ban来防止暴力破解攻击。sudo apt install fail2ban
sudo systemctl enable fail2ban
sudo systemctl start fail2ban
sudo setenforce 1
lynis进行系统安全审计。sudo lynis audit system
通过实施这些措施,你可以显著提高Linux系统的安全性,减少恶意软件攻击的风险。记住,安全是一个持续的过程,需要定期评估和更新你的安全策略。